Definition & Meaning of ILYSM
ILYSM stands for:
I Love You So Much
It is a popular internet abbreviation used to express strong affection, appreciation, or care toward someone.
People often use ILYSM when they want to show more emotion than simply saying “love you.” The phrase adds extra emphasis through the words “so much.”
Basic Meaning
When someone says ILYSM, they are usually expressing:
- Deep affection
- Strong friendship
- Gratitude
- Romantic feelings
- Emotional support

Background & History
The abbreviation ILYSM developed from the earlier phrase ILY, which means “I Love You.”
As texting became popular during the early 2000s, people looked for faster ways to type common phrases. Limited character counts on text messages encouraged users to create abbreviations.
Evolution
The progression often looked like this:
- I Love You
- ILY
- ILYSM
Adding SM (“So Much”) helped users express stronger emotions without typing the full phrase.

Common Misconceptions & Clarifications
Many people misunderstand ILYSM because it contains the phrase “I love you.”
Misconception 1: It Is Always Romantic
This is false.
Friends, siblings, and family members often use ILYSM without romantic intent.
Misconception 2: It Is Only for Teenagers
While younger users use it often, adults also use it in casual conversations.
Misconception 3: It Is Unprofessional Everywhere
It is informal, but not offensive. The issue is context rather than meaning.
Misconception 4: It Means Something Inappropriate
No. The standard meaning is simply:
“I Love You So Much”
There is no commonly accepted offensive definition.

Hidden or Offensive Meanings
Does ILYSM Have Hidden Meanings?
Generally, no.
The accepted meaning remains:
I Love You So Much
Can It Be Used Sarcastically?
Yes.
Some people use it humorously or sarcastically.
Example:
“You crashed the server again. ILYSM 🙄”
In this case, the speaker may actually be expressing frustration.
Why Context Matters
The same abbreviation can have different meanings depending on:
- Tone
- Emojis
- Relationship
- Situation
Always read the entire conversation before interpreting it.
